The advertising campaign promoted MTN’s Shesh@600 5G/LTE home internet package. The Advertising Appeals Committee (AAC) has dismissed an appeal by MTN South Africa over its advertising of a “free-to-use” router in its Shesh@600 home internet package, upholding a ruling that found the claim to be misleading.
